Labour & Employment Law

The Labour & Employment Law Section focuses on the contemporary legal issues in both the union and non-union sectors of the workplace. At each meeting, leading practitioners from both sides of the bar speak on legislative changes, the impact of new jurisprudence and practice management issues.

The speakers and meeting attendees also share practical (and tactical) insights about how to practice more effectively. The Section provides an excellent means for CBA Alberta members to stay abreast of developments in this broad and dynamic practice area.
